Output 5f58469d82dc7de979737081b1ca23e143eb76eaca871ad3f891bbf55bf00748:0

value
17647745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 396ddab469a29f43f563562fdcd76d119fb63b79 OP_EQUALVERIFY OP_CHECKSIG
address
16Ef7kGUNgjqZFbX8zghgK1CAb9viZYsPR
transaction
5f58469d82dc7de979737081b1ca23e143eb76eaca871ad3f891bbf55bf00748
confirmations
463015
spent
true